2+ Real Estate & Homes for Sale in Snow Road Estates, la Mesa

8338 Green Run Rd, La Mesa, NM, 88044-9485 | Card Image

MLS® 2600781 • keller williams realty

8354 Rancho Vista Loop, La Mesa, NM, 88044-9724 | Card Image

MLS® 2503646 • Exit Realty Horizons